  • Patent number: 3934595
    Abstract: Copolymers having tertiary amine groups and composed of 16 - 43% methyl methacrylate, 25 - 54% dimethylamino ethyl methacrylate and 12 - 52% octadecyl methacrylate are particularly useful as hair treating resins with conventional carriers and additives. The copolymers can be crosslinked by up to 0.15 by an unsaturated agent to produce preferred copolymers used in wavesetting lotions in amounts of 1 - 3%. Such copolymers can also be partially or wholly quaternized by a quaternizing agent. Those copolymers not crosslinked are particularly useful as hair lacquers, especially in aerosol sprays in amounts of 1 - 4%. The molecular weight for the subject copolymers average 10,000 - 1,500,000 and copolymerization can be effected in a solvent with a catalyst wherein the reaction mixture is heated for about 6 to 24 hours at about 80.degree.C. When applied to the hair, the amount of lotion or lacquer used can be 10 - 100 cc. and the treated hair is rolled.
